WebIn plasmid pZDHY95-VIM-2, bla VIM-2 is integrated into the class I integron In1722, designated by the INTEGRALL database, and the gene cassette array was 5ʹCS-aacA4ʹ-30-bla VIM-2-aacA4ʹ-3ʹCS. Unlike the typical class I integron, the 3ʹCS of In1722 was replaced by tniC/R, a functional transposon in Tn402 (Tn5090), instead of the qacEΔ1/sul1. WebAug 6, 2024 · Yang, Y. et al.
